Veteran Nollywood actress Iyabo Ojo has challenged societal narratives regarding single mothers in Nigeria, asserting that the shame once associated with raising a child alone has dissipated.
Changing Perceptions
According to the screen diva, the dynamic has shifted, and men are now actively pursuing women who have raised children, valuing their experience and the success of their offspring.
She stated:
“Single motherhood is not a stigma anymore. Men are begging us single mothers to marry them because we have experience. Because the children of single mothers are making it,”
Online Backlash
Her assertion has ignited a firestorm of debate on social media. While the discussion touches on evolving gender roles, many netizens accused the actress of hypocrisy, questioning whether she would hold the same standard for her own son.
